Transaction 35a71c69083ed48b41e40611b3b9041de4844a766f526c310f8965c619345910
1 Input
2 Outputs
- 35a71c69083ed48b41e40611b3b9041de4844a766f526c310f8965c619345910:0
- 35a71c69083ed48b41e40611b3b9041de4844a766f526c310f8965c619345910:1
value 53000000
address 1H9DKjQNTwPsNrJZp9PeAbNrBAKVvubats
value 56188891
address 1PH8wMZdehyfivf5P4izZqUCXRyXM6PENt